Toshiba Satellite Pro NB10t-A-108 11.6 inch notebook for students

With the Satellite Pro NB10t-A-108 would like Toshiba to offer pupils or students a low-priced entry-level notebook and business users the ideal secondary device on the go. The highlights of the 1.5-pound mobile PCs will include a HD display with LED backlighting that brings a touch function with it.
In conjunction with the touch controls designed and pre-installed Windows 8 (64-bit version) allows the screen by the user via the controller and cue use. Whether organizing the application tiles, navigating through the web, playing games or scrolling through text and images - everything works as needed as with a tablet PC by touching the display. Of course, the notebook can also use classical means clickpad and comfortable keyboard.

Cheap entry models

Who needs no touch function, is better off with the Satellite Pro NB10-A-109. Until We display both have laptops on the same equipment. The Satellite Pro NB10t-A-108 with touch screen function costing 419 EUR, per derSatellite NB10-A-109 without touch function is 200 grams lighter and is 369 EUR (including VAT). Both models are from mid-December is available in Europe.

Everything important on board

The lightweight and compact devices are compatible with all Windows applications and easy to use. Because you can install the same applications on the Satellite Pro models, exactly like on the possibly existing desktop PC, the devices are also as a second PC .Compatibility problems are just as little to fear as lack of synchronization capabilities. Both notebooks are waiting for with interfaces such as WLAN, Bluetooth or Ethernet LAN. Any kind of data is available on the integrated 500 GB hard disk space. To protect against theft - while working in the university library or meeting breaks - there is a device for a Kensington ® lock. Thanks to Intel ® processor, the mobile PCs have grown all used office and web applications and are also available for entering large amounts of text available.

Extensive Connectivity

Despite its compact dimensions, there are many interfaces. They are designed in standard size and do not require special cables or in addition to acquiring adapter. About a VGA and HDMI port can be larger external displays such as TVs or projectors connect - ideal for presentations that can then be controlled via the touch screen. The built-in speaker of the Satellite Pro NB10t models give stereo sound in high quality re-optimized by DTS ® Sound . One of the three USB ports corresponding to the USB 3.0 standard and ensures fast data transfers.Via SD card slot allows data to, for example, cameras exchange.

Facts & Figures

Satellite Pro NB10t-A-108
• Display: 11.6 inches (29.5 
cm) HD Touch Display 
(1366 x 768) with LED backlight 
(ten-point touchscreen) 
• Operating system: Windows 
8 64-bit (preinstalled) 
• Processor: Intel Celeron N2810 
• Graphics: Intel HD graphics 
• Hard disk: 500 GB HDD 
• Memory: 2 GB DDR3 (1600 MHz) 
• Connectivity: WiFi b / g / n, Ethernet LAN, Bluetooth 4.0, 1x USB 3.0 , 2x USB 2.0, HDMI, SD / SDHC card slot, Microphone input / headphone output 
• Webcam: 0.9 MP HD with built-in microphone 
• touchpad with gesture recognition 
• Dimensions: 284 x 208.6 x 13.8 to 25.1 mm , 
weight: 1.5 kg 
• RRP including VAT: 419 EUR

Bluetooth Portable Speakers: what is the best?

In recent years, the Bluetooth speakers are fashionable. Easily transportable , with autonomy for several hours and often a lot better than a smartphone, they have gradually replaced the iPod docks.
The first advantage of pregnant Bluetooth on the dock is the fact of not having to connect the audio source to the speaker.Your smartphone or tablet can remain in your pocket or bag and play music all the same, provided you stay five or ten meters from the enclosure. Another advantage, the Bluetooth speakers are universal , unlike, for example AirPlay speakers. Thus, you can send your music from an Android device, iOS, Windows Phone, BlackBerry, and even from a laptop or desktop as it is equipped for Bluetooth.

Facebook in Germany successfully



The social network Facebook is one according to their own data in Germany 19 million hits daily and corresponds to approximately 25 percent of the population. The majority use Facebook with a mobile app specifically log in 13 million every day with their smartphone or tablet into a platform. The monthly user figures amount to 25 million while Facebook users in Germany € 53.7 million counts. The advertising on smartphones and tablets developed for Facebook to a lucrative source of income.

The apps controlled in the second quarter with a 41 per cent share of the advertising revenue. The NSA spy scandal caused in recent weeks of negative press over Facebook. The Company founder Marc Zuckerberg now condemned the behavior of the U.S. government in relation to the Internet of the U.S. secret NSA spying. Due to the booming advertising revenue, its 1.15 billion users and increasing sales in the market value of Facebook recently climbed to 110 billion U.S. dollars.

Microsoft: smartphones, "the biggest regret" Steve Ballmer

Microsoft boss, who will leave the company next year, acknowledged having missed the turn of smartphones was "the thing he regretted most."



The head of Microsoft Steve Ballmer , who is leaving the group , acknowledged Thursday that his biggest regret was to have missed the turn of the mobile , but for him the computer giant has not yet admitting defeat in this area.

"Virtually no market share"


"I wish there was a period in the early 2000s when we were so focused on what we had to do with Windows that we have not been able to redeploy talent to a new device called the smartphone. This is the thing I regret the most, "Ballmer said during a conference call with analysts. "It would have been better for Windows and our success in other forms" of products, has he added.
Market of smartphones and tablets are now dominated by Apple rivals (with the iPhone and iPad) and Google (many manufacturers use the Android software). Microsoft itself has "virtually no market share" in mobile devices, Ballmer conceded, but felt that the group had suddenly "growth opportunities."
For phones , it relies on the recently announced acquisition of mobile phones Nokia Finnish group , with which he was already working to produce smartphones running under Windows, the Lumia.
In tablets , the Surface launched last year has not wowed the audience. Microsoft has had to significantly lower prices , which resulted in a charge of nearly a billion dollars in its latest quarterly results. new generation of these devices , however, must be presented next Monday.

No details on the successor to Ballmer


Beyond mobile devices, Microsoft, according to Ballmer, significant opportunities available in the services of cloud computing , online subscriptions for example its office suite Office or the search engine Bing .
Ballmer has not yet buried the PC , despite the crisis in that product, which Microsoft is associated, but is challenged by the tablet. "We must work to ensure that the PC is the device of preference for people when they are trying to be productive," he has said.
Microsoft also said at the conference how his recent internal reorganization would affect the presentation of its financial results. He did not, however, elaborate on the ongoing search for a successor to Mr. Ballmer.

Parrot introduces two new drones

The CES is traditionally the living room where Parrot unveils new products. Last year, it was the Flower Power that created the surprise, a dedicated plant care object. For the year 2014, the French brand revives one of its greatest successes: the drones. Four years after the first AR.Drone, followed two years later a new version, the rhythm is quite regular. But this time, it is not one but two new developments that are presented. The first is the Mini Drone . This greatly reduced the AR. Drone (70 grams!) Version shows the outline. It is always a quadricopter that is controlled with an app for smartphone and tablet, but it still displays some notable differences with his big brother.Where it is intended more for large spaces, Mini Drone favors interiors. An enabling environment to fly, but also roll. Two large wheels are attached to each side of the drone with a double interest: protect propellers during impacts, but more importantly, allow the unit to roll on the ground, even on the walls and even the ceiling! Autonomy is planned for the moment 6/7 minutes, while connectivity is provided by the latest standard Bluetooth Low Energy 4 , which limits the scope to ten meters (enough for an indoor environment).

Jumping robot
The second is even more intriguing because it really leaves the beaten track. the Jumping Sumo .This little robot is able to move quite conventional, that is to say while driving, but can also jump. Its spring and two independent rubber wheels provide him a range of about 1 meter in height while the pace is more swift: it can take corners at high speed and can even turn on itself. On the same principle as other drones of the firm, the Jumping Sumo driver using an implementation , but this time connectivity is ensured by WiFi . The scope is larger suite, up to 50 meters. Autonomy is also larger, about 20 minutes. Especially, a small QVGA camera is placed on the robot to track its evolution. Neither of these drones is not yet completely finished, which is why we do not have precise launch date or price, although Parrot dares to speak of arrival in the current year.
